Verdict

Chilli Filli beat CASABLANCA MIX a length in this last year but the runner-up is 8lb better off and has the benefit of a recent run this time. Nicky Henderson’s mare, also a close second in the race in 2018, can take her revenge with Momella held by Chilli Filli on their run together at Perth in April. Midnightreferendum has a chance at the weights on her best form and Win My Wings was in fine form in the spring while Organdi took a step forward at Exeter last month.
